Abstract
Within the framework of fracture mechanics the fatigue of polymers is chara cterised by the rate of crack propagation as a function of the amplitude an d frequency of the stress intensity factor. The measurements are performed by starting with a notched specimen to be independent of inherent natural o r surface defects. In application of this method some experimental question s have come about, some of which are dealt with in this work. In particular , the measurement of crack propagation, the influence of the shape of the s pecimen and the applied frequency, the measurement with constant or increas ing stress intensity amplitude and the propagating crack as a signal for tr ansitions in internal deformation mechanisms.
